There has been a hand full of IX's, including mine, that have a noisy Timing Belt. Some dealers will say it's the Belt, some say it's the Tensioner, other will say it's the Idler. The fix I've seen, is to replace all three at the same time. And before you ask, good luck trying to get the dealer to replace all three.
timing belt noise
I have same problem on my 13k evo IX. I used a long screw driver to listen to all the components and pulley relate to timing belt, but I did not hear anything. with my experience at work i deal with machinery belt at all the time. it must be the timing belt itself. I guess the engine is too hot that why it make the timing belt dry out after period of time. I used a water spray bottle sprayed on the timing belt (do not wet the timing belt) to test if the noise went away. Yes the fck?/** noise went away for couple ride and the engine is super quiet. I also used the timing belt dresser made by STP spray on the timing belt, this time it last a little longer. I didn't have time to take off the under timing belt cover to inspect the tensioner. why don't you try to spray some water to see if it go away. Do not forget to take the upper cover off. Next timing belt service, I will try out HKS belt to see if anything better. good luck
